An open plan sitting room is a modern design concept that combines living spaces, typically integrating the living room, dining area, and kitchen into one large, cohesive area. This layout promotes a sense of spaciousness and encourages social interaction.

Introduction

The open plan sitting room is becoming increasingly popular among homeowners and interior designers alike. This innovative design approach eliminates barriers between spaces, allowing for a seamless flow from the living area to the dining and kitchen spaces. By choosing an open plan sitting room, you can create a bright and airy environment that enhances both functionality and aesthetics.

Key benefits of an open plan sitting room include:
  • Enhanced natural light, as fewer walls mean more windows and light sources.
  • Greater versatility in furniture arrangement, allowing for creative layouts.
  • A more sociable atmosphere, perfect for entertaining guests and family gatherings.
  • Improved accessibility, especially for families with young children or individuals with mobility challenges.
When designing your open plan sitting room, consider incorporating elements that define each area without closing them off. For instance, use rugs to delineate spaces, or strategically place furniture to create cozy nooks. FAQs

How can I choose the best layout for my open plan sitting room?

Consider the flow of movement between spaces, the natural light available, and how you plan to use each area. Experiment with different furniture arrangements to find what feels most comfortable.

What are the key features to look for when selecting furniture for an open plan sitting room?

Choose versatile, multi-functional furniture that can serve different purposes. Look for pieces that complement each other in style and color to maintain a cohesive look.

Are there any common mistakes people make when designing an open plan sitting room?

Yes, common mistakes include overcrowding the space with too much furniture, neglecting to define areas, and choosing colors that clash instead of complementing each other.

How can I maintain privacy in an open plan sitting room?

Use furniture placement, area rugs, and decorative screens to create distinct zones. You can also incorporate plants or shelving to add a sense of separation while maintaining openness.

What styles work best for an open plan sitting room?

Popular styles include modern, minimalist, and Scandinavian designs, which emphasize simplicity and functionality. However, you can adapt any style to fit an open plan layout by focusing on cohesive elements.
